The authors, leaders at PBLworks or what used to be the Buck Institute for education, provide a gold standard for project-based learning. Today’s projects need to be rigorous, engaging, and in-depth, and they need to have student voice and choice built in. The step-by-step process of how to create, implement, and assess PBL is addressed for both school leaders and teachers.
